Specific Examples of Suspension Issues
To illustrate the problem, let's examine some concrete examples provided by players. One player, xxtwinnes, reported incidents involving both the BF400 and the Tracker. In one instance, while chasing a Sahara Twin on the BF400, both vehicles executed the same jump. The Sahara Twin landed without issue, but xxtwinnes was thrown off the BF400. A similar situation occurred with the Tracker, where another MOTO fell off after performing a jump that should have been manageable. These incidents highlight a critical disparity in performance between the BF400/Tracker and other bikes, suggesting a potential flaw in the suspension tuning of these vehicles. Suspension Tuning and Adjustments
One of the most effective ways to address the suspension issues is through targeted tuning and adjustments. This involves modifying specific parameters within the game's physics engine to alter the behavior of the BF400 and Tracker's suspension systems. Some key areas to focus on include: Spring Stiffness: Adjusting the spring stiffness can affect how the suspension absorbs impacts. A softer spring might provide a more comfortable ride on rough terrain, but it could also lead to excessive bottoming out on larger jumps. A stiffer spring, on the other hand, might handle jumps better but could result in a harsher ride overall. Finding the right balance is crucial. Damping Rates: Damping controls the rate at which the suspension compresses and rebounds. Properly tuned damping can help prevent the vehicle from bouncing excessively after an impact, improving stability and control. Wheel Travel: The amount of wheel travel available affects the suspension's ability to absorb large bumps and jumps. Increasing wheel travel can provide more cushioning, but it can also impact the vehicle's handling and stability. By carefully adjusting these parameters, developers can fine-tune the suspension to provide a more predictable and reliable ride experience.
